The left lobe of the thyroid gland is one of the two lateral lobes that compose the butterfly-shaped thyroid gland, located in the lower anterior neck. The thyroid gland consists of a right lobe and a left lobe, connected by a midline structure called the isthmus. Each lobe lies on either side of the trachea, just below the Adam's apple (thyroid cartilage), extending from approximately the level of C5 superiorly to T1 inferiorly. Each lobe has an average length of approximately 50-60 mm, and the entire gland typically weighs around 25-30 grams.

Anatomical relationships: The left lobe, like the right, is enveloped by the visceral fascia and is covered anteriorly and laterally by the strap muscles (sternothyroid, sternohyoid, and the superior belly of the omohyoid). It is attached to the laryngotracheal complex by the anterior suspensory ligament and the posterior suspensory ligament (ligament of Berry), which connects it to the cricoid cartilage and the first and second tracheal rings.

The blood supply derives from the superior and inferior thyroid arteries.

Asymmetry between lobes: The right lobe is generally larger than the left lobe.
